EUR/USD Dips Amidst Weak German Business Climate

EUR/USD Dips Overview

The EUR/USD currency pair has recently shown signs of decline, primarily influenced by the deteriorating sentiment in the German business climate. Economic indicators suggest a downturn, compelling many analysts to adjust their forecasts for the euro's future performance.

Factors Influencing the EUR/USD Movement

  • Recent reports indicate a contraction in Germany's manufacturing sector.
  • Economic sentiment data points to increased caution among businesses.
  • The strength of the US dollar remains a significant factor affecting the EUR/USD exchange rate.

Potential Future Implications

The weakening business climate in Germany raises questions about the overall health of the eurozone economy. Investors are urged to monitor developments closely, as sustained weakness could further pressure the euro against the dollar.
